We compared two Desktop platform GPUs: 4GB VRAM FirePro W8000 and 2GB VRAM Radeon R7 350 640SP to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
AMD FirePro W8000 's Advantages
More VRAM (4GB vs 2GB)
Larger VRAM bandwidth (176.0GB/s vs 72.00GB/s)
1152 additional rendering cores
AMD Radeon R7 350 640SP 's Advantages
Released 6 years and 7 months late
Lower TDP (55W vs 225W)
